支持解决ODBC无Oracle支持问题(odbc中无oracle)
支持解决ODBC无Oracle支持问题
在现代商业应用程序中,ODBC(开放式数据库连接)已成为数据交换的标准。但是,一些情况下,ODBC无法连接到Oracle数据库系统。这可能会导致许多问题,例如:
– 无法执行SQL查询
– 无法连接到Oracle数据库
– 应用程序中缺少必要的ODBC驱动程序
以下是一些操作和技巧,可以帮助解决这些问题。
解决方案一:使用ODBC连接Oracle数据库
对于ODBC连接Oracle数据库的情况,应遵循以下步骤:
1. 安装正确的ODBC驱动程序
下载和安装适用于您的操作系统的ODBC驱动程序。除了Oracle官方的驱动程序,还有其他第三方提供的驱动程序。
2. 配置ODBC数据源
在控制面板的管理工具中,选择ODBC Data Sources,然后选择“添加”以创建新的数据源。
3. 测试ODBC连接
通过ODBC数据源测试你的连接。在ODBC连接工具中,可以通过单击“测试连接”按钮来测试连接是否成功。如果连接失败,则需要重新检查连接设置。
4. 使用ODBC连接Oracle
在你的应用程序中,可以使用ODBC连接来访问Oracle数据库。根据您的ODBC驱动程序的不同,这可能包括在连接字符串或配置文件中提供需要的参数。注意,在ODBC连接中使用的SQL命令可能不同于直接在Oracle控制台中使用的命令。
解决方案二:使用ODBC代理
如果您无法直接在ODBC中连接Oracle数据库,可以尝试使用ODBC代理。ODBC代理是一种允许ODBC与其他数据库系统通信的软件。它充当ODBC驱动程序和其他驱动程序之间的“翻译器”。
下面是使用ODBC代理连接Oracle数据库时的步骤:
1. 下载和安装ODBC代理软件
常用的ODBC代理软件有iODBC和unixODBC。在使用它们之前,需要根据您的系统和ODBC设置来选择适当的软件。
2. 配置ODBC代理
在控制台的管理工具中打开ODBC代理管理器,然后选择“添加”。在添加过程中,您需要提供要连接的数据库的详细信息。例如,您需要提供数据库的名称、用户名和密码等。
3. 测试ODBC代理
使用ODBC代理测试你的连接。与第一种解决方案类似,单击“测试连接”按钮以验证可以成功连接到数据库。
4. 使用ODBC代理连接Oracle
在你的应用程序中,可以使用ODBC代理作为Oracle数据库的中介。使用ODBC代理必须通过ODBC代理软件的设置,以正确配置中介参数。同时,应用程序也需要针对ODBC代理进行配置。
5. 运行你的应用程序
当你成功配置ODBC代理并在应用程序中实现它之后,你需要运行应用程序并验证能够以正确的参数连接到Oracle数据库。
总结:
ODBC是一种广泛使用的数据交换协议,而Oracle是一种广泛使用的关系数据库系统。尽管ODBC与Oracle有时会出现连接问题,但是应用适当的技巧和解决方案,这些连接问题是可以被解决的。